OAKLAND, Maine (AP) — Police in the Maine town of Oakland are looking for a pig that threatened two children walking through the woods.

Capt. Rick Stubbert tells the Morning Sentinel (http://bit.ly/1w4FF9U ) that the children were walking along a trail in the wooded area between the local middle school and the high school at about 1:45 p.m. Tuesday when the pig confronted them "screaming at the kids and chasing them."

The children were so frightened they flagged down a police officer. Police did not disclose the children's age.

Officers, including animal control, responded to the scene, and although they found tracks that confirmed the pig was real, they didn't find the animal.

Stubbert says he doesn't know where the pig came from or why it might have been acting aggressively.
